Shibaura SD1840 Specs, Price and Review (2026)

Lawn · 17.8 HP · Best for small farms and versatility

Power

17.8 HP (13 kW)

Fuel

Diesel

Transmission

Manual

PTO

15 HP @ 540 rpm

Weight

933 kg (1 t)

New price (est.)

$3,076 – $4,614

Est. used price

$923 – $2,999

Overview

The Shibaura SD1840 is a 17.8 HP lawn and garden tractor built for mowing, property maintenance, and light attachments. Engine Specifications

The Shibaura SD1840 is powered by a diesel engine that delivers 17.8 HP for property maintenance. Tractor horsepower is a critical specification that determines the machine's ability to handle various implements. The engine specifications demonstrate Shibaura's engineering expertise in creating efficient powerplants.

  • Maximum Power: 17.8 HP (13 kW)
  • Fuel Type: Diesel
  • Cooling System: Liquid-cooled
